About Northeastern University
Founded in 1923, Northeastern University (NEU) is a multi-disciplinary university located in Shenyang, the central city of Northeast China. The University offers 66 undergraduate programs, 181 graduate programs, and 100 doctoral programs. While still laying stress on basic sciences (Metallurgy, Material Science, Mechanical, Mining), the university has paid special attention to the development of applied sciences (Automation, Computer, Biomedical Engineering) and social science (Philosophy of Science and Technology, Management and Administration). In September 2013, there were 27,157 undergraduates, 6,289 postgraduates and 3,121 doctoral candidates.
